Is FX24 regulated?
No. FX24, operated by Big Ray Finance Group LLC, is not authorised by any top-tier regulator such as the FCA, SEC, ASIC, or CySEC. Independent broker-monitoring checks confirm that FX24 has no valid forex regulation and flag it as high risk.
The company is associated with the United Arab Emirates, but a registration or an address is not the same as a financial licence. To legally offer trading services, a broker needs authorisation from a recognised regulator that supervises how it operates and how it holds client money. FX24 has none, which means there is no oversight, no compensation scheme, and no ombudsman standing behind your funds.
The red flags
- No valid regulation, confirmed. Broker databases list FX24 as having no valid regulatory licence and advise caution.
- Little public information. There is scant verifiable detail about who runs FX24 or its track record. Legitimate brokers are transparent about their regulation, ownership, and history; FX24 is not.
- A very high-deposit account tier. Records show account structures ranging from a modest entry deposit up to a tier requiring around €25,000. Steep minimum deposits paired with account managers are a common feature of high-pressure, high-risk operations.
- Contradictory and template-style claims. The platform’s own material has claimed that trading with it “operates under regulatory oversight,” which is simply untrue for an unregulated broker. That kind of misleading reassurance is itself a warning sign.
What this means for your money
Because FX24 is unregulated, there is nothing protecting your deposit. If a withdrawal is delayed or refused, you have no regulator to escalate to and no compensation scheme to fall back on. Deposits routed through Tether and regional payment methods add further risk, since crypto transactions are effectively irreversible. With an unregulated broker, that combination leaves you badly exposed.
